Sule Sacks Two Aides in Sudden Shake-Up
SSA on NG-CARES, Media Assistant Relieved of Duties with Immediate Effect
By Suleiman Abubakar Rimi Uku Lafia
Governor Abdullahi Sule of Nasarawa State has approved the dismissal of two of his aides in a move that signals a fresh shake-up within the state government.
Those affected are Yusuf Galadima Aliyu, who served as Senior Special Assistant (SSA) on NG-CARES, and Abdullahi Chiroma Magaji, Special Assistant (SA) on Media.
The development was disclosed in a statement issued on Thursday by the Secretary to the Government of Nasarawa State, Dr. Labaran Shuaibu Magaji, SAN.
According to the statement dated April 16, 2026, the disengagement of the two officials takes immediate effect.
No official reason was provided for their removal.
